Top 10 Essential Self-Defense Techniques for Everyday Situations
Self-defense is a critical skill that everyone should consider mastering, as it can empower individuals to protect themselves in various situations. Understanding the top 10 essential self-defense techniques can help you feel more confident and prepared. These techniques are designed for practical everyday encounters and can be adapted to fit your personal safety needs. Here are the key techniques to consider:
- Avoiding Confrontation: The best self-defense strategy is to avoid dangerous situations whenever possible. Awareness of your surroundings and the ability to recognize potential threats can prevent many altercations.
- Verbal De-escalation: Using your words effectively can often diffuse a tense situation before it escalates into violence. Practice staying calm and assertively communicating.
- Blocking: Learn how to effectively block an incoming strike to minimize injury and create an opportunity to escape.
- Pushing: If someone is too close for comfort, a strong push can create distance and deter the aggressor.
- Joint Locks: Techniques that involve manipulating an opponent's joints can incapacitate them temporarily, giving you a chance to escape.
- Kicking: Targeting vulnerable areas such as the knee or groin can provide a significant advantage in an altercation.
- Escaping Holds: Knowing how to break free from common holds is essential; practice these techniques regularly.
- Defensive Stance: Maintaining a solid stance can help you respond better to attacks and maintain balance.
- Using Objects: Everyday items can be used defensively, so learn to improvise if necessary.
- Seeking Help: Don’t hesitate to call for help or alert authorities if you feel threatened. Having a plan can make all the difference.

How to Create a Personal Safety Plan: Tips and Tools
Creating a personal safety plan is essential for both peace of mind and preparedness in various situations. Start by assessing your environment; identify potential risks at home, work, and while traveling. Make a list of emergency contacts, including friends, family, and local authorities, and keep this list updated. Additionally, consider incorporating safety apps that provide quick access to help or resources. These tools can equip you with the necessary information and support in case of emergency.
Next, outline specific strategies and actions tailored to your unique circumstances. For instance, create a safe word with your family or friends that signals you need help. Have an evacuation plan in place, especially for children or pets, and practice it regularly. Consider enrolling in self-defense classes or workshops to boost your confidence and skills. By taking these proactive steps, you empower yourself to handle unexpected situations effectively.
Are You Prepared? Common Misconceptions About Personal Safety and Protection
When it comes to personal safety and protection, many individuals harbor common misconceptions that can lead to a false sense of security. One prevalent belief is that personal safety is solely the responsibility of law enforcement or security professionals. In reality, while these entities play a crucial role, individual awareness and proactive measures are vital. Taking simple steps such as understanding your environment, being alert, and having a safety plan in place can significantly enhance your personal safety. Additionally, many people think that safety tools like pepper spray or personal alarms are only for the overly cautious; however, these tools can provide an important layer of protection for anyone.
Another misconception is that personal safety measures are only necessary in high-crime areas. The truth is, incidents can occur anywhere, and being prepared is essential regardless of your surroundings. For example, self-defense training is often overlooked, as people assume they won't ever need it. However, having the skills to protect yourself not only enhances your physical safety but also boosts your confidence in daily situations. To effectively prepare for potential threats, it is essential to educate yourself about personal safety strategies and to challenge your own beliefs around safety and protection.
